    As a key member of the team reporting to the Executive Director, this role will be responsible for building and maintaining positive and productive relationships between and: alumni, mentors, other BU departments, and ecosystem partners in Boston/MAs tech, social impact, non-profit, and government spaces.

    The focus for this position is to connect BU and external resources to students to help them advance their innovation and entrepreneurial efforts.



    Job Functions:

    Mentorship:
    Maintain and build the mentoring network that provides mechanisms for matching mentors with students in programs, competitions.

    The mentor network should balance the needs of our current students with scalability and ensuring that mentors represent a wide range of expertise, industries, skills and backgrounds with a strong attention to ensuring diverse candidates are available for all students.

    Work with BU alumni and area experts to build a strong network of judges and experts to support students from a wide range of expertise.


    Alumni Relations:


    Support and collaborate with the Office of Development and Alumni Relations to recommend, develop, and organize innovation engagement opportunities directed specifically at alumni, either leveraging existing programming for students or by creating unique programming.

    Collaborate with the program managers on implementation.

    Donor Relations:


    In partnership with the Executive Director, support donor stewardship activities, such as finding opportunities for donors to participate in the activities of .


    Create connections across BU:
    Develop and nurture mutually beneficial relationships across BU schools and organizations for the benefit of students.
    Develop relationships with external organizations to benefit students

    Work with staff, funders, the Executive Director and outside groups to develop and offer internships and opportunities for students such as Enlight Summer Social Impact Internship.


    Promotion in the Ecosystem:


    Help promote by attending local ecosystem events, getting staff placed as Judges, Panelists & Speakers at innovation events in and around Boston.

    Partner with local ecosystem groups on event promotion and other opportunities to grow our partner network. Collect metrics that measure the teams engagement with the local innovation ecosystem.


    Innovator/Entrepreneur in Residence Program:


    Help identify and recruit leading northeast entrepreneurs and social impact leaders who can support mission through events, judging, provide inspiration and who can create measurable impact in the BU community over the duration of their appointment.

    Required Skills

    Bachelor's degree required.

    A minimum of five years' experience in relationship or community management, either in fundraising, government affairs, or the startup ecosystem along with excellent oral and written communications skills are all strongly desired.

    Preference will be given to candidates with proven interest and background in innovation and entrepreneurship ecosystem knowledge.
    Must have event planning experience.
    We seek a forward-thinking and goals-oriented individual who can work both independently and as part of a team.
